From Farmington Police Department:

Wednesday, April 2, 2025

The Farmington Police Department has arrested and charged Heather Fernandez-Hoefer (51) with second-degree murder and tampering with evidence in connection with a 2020 homicide.

On November 29, 2020, officers responded to a residence in the 700 block of South Ivie Avenue regarding a report of an unresponsive individual. Upon arrival, officers discovered Robert Hoefer (49) deceased from three apparent stab wounds. Heather Fernandez-Hoefer, who made the 911 call, provided conflicting statements during the initial investigation.

After a thorough and ongoing investigation by detectives and working with the district attorney's office, a thorough review of the case was conducted, and the decision to proceed with criminal charges was made. A warrant was issued to charge Heather Fernandez-Hoefer. She was taken into custody without incident on April 1, 2025.
